Circle P has a circumfrence of aproximately 75 inches what is the aproximate length of the radius, r? Use 3.14 for pi. Round to
ratelena [41]

Answer:

The approximate length of the radius, r is 12 inch.

Step-by-step explanation:

Given:

A circle P is given having circumference C,

C = 75 inch

pi = π = 3.14

radius = r

To Find:

radius = r = ?

Solution:

Circumference:

In geometry, the circumference (from Latin circumferens, meaning "carrying around") of a circle is the (linear) distance around it.

That is, the circumference would be the length of the circle if it were opened up and straightened out to a line segment.

Formula is given as

Circumference=2\pi (radius)

Substituting the values we get

75 = 2 × 3.14 × r

∴ r =\frac{75}{2\times 3.14}\\ \\r=\frac{75}{6.28} \\\\r=11.942\ inches

We approximate radius to

radius = 12 inich
